Could you shut the iPhone down while still in the restore process?

As a last resort download the iOS 6.0.1 for your iPhone and put in the ˜/Library/iTunes/iPhoneSoftwareUpdates folder while deleting the 7.02 file that is there now. Then do the Restore in iTunes.

But this only works if your iPhone was never hacked/jailbroken.

iPhone3,1_6.0.1_10A523_Restore.ipsw

Dear Elegant,

Error 3194

Occurs when trying to install an old firmware and Apple's server disallows the installation.

if you have download iOS 7 and trying to restore it with iOS 7 you will not be able to since iOS 7.0.2 is out and apple do not allow to restore device with older version is new one is already available.


you can download your device iOS 7.0.2 from the below link

iPhone 4 GSM - http://appldnld.apple.com/iOS7/091-9871.20130924.7imYu/iPhone3,1_7.0.2_11A501_Re store.ipsw


iPhone 4 GSM (Rev A) - http://appldnld.apple.com/iOS7/091-9821.20130924.jJ61o/iPhone3,2_7.0.2_11A501_Re store.ipsw


Once you have downloaded your required firmware, in iTunes connect you iDevice and press restore with shift key on keyboard. this will give an option to select the iOS file from which you want to restore , select the downloaded file wait for the process to complete.


you're done , enjoy iOS 7.0.2!!!
